Descubra Como o Reconhecimento Facial Pode Proteger Sua Privacidade

1.62k views1774 WordsCopy TextShare
Sandeco
Entre no nosso grupo de suporte do whatsapp e fale comigo. Sério, eu estou lá e é tudo gratuito. ht...
Video Transcript:
Olá tudo bem Olha só já fiz aqui no canal uma série sobre reconhecimento facial tudo em Python do zero né então agora eu quero fazer uma uma um Plus para essa série que é exatamente a gente fazer a o reconhecimento facial sem a necessidade de programar usando o Orange Canvas vai ser bem simples bem tranquilo de ver tá bom antes de qualquer coisa eu queria falar sobre os nossos grupos temáticos no WhatsApp né tudo sobre a são 14 grupos temáticos aí aí mais de 8. 500 profissionais de várias áreas do conhecimento falando sobre inteligência artificial O link tá aqui na descrição basta você clicar entrar você é meu convidado será muito bom ter você lá tá bom eu vou usar um Data Set de fotos minhas né e da minha esposa Etiene dos Meus dois filhos Rafael e o Pedro eu vou mostrar para vocês como a gente pode fazer reconhecimento facial simplificado sem necessidade de programar aqui no h Canvas Tá bom vamos pro computador então muito bem já estamos aqui no Orange Canvas aberto eu estou usando aqui a versão do Orange ó est usando a versão 3. 34 já at 3.
34. 1 tá E lembrando que para poder usar esse reconhecimento facial a gente vai precisar do Edom você precisa que você instalar aí no Edom esse Edom aqui do image Analytics tá porque a gente vai usar Deep learning uma rede de learning para poder fazer o reconhecimento facial dentro do Orange incrível né então eu tenho aqui já aberto ó esse image Analytics vou mostrar para vocês o meu dataset de imagens né Tá aqui o meu dataset de imagens eh tem fotos da minha esposa certo são fotos mesmo não precisa das do rosto somente né mas se você tiver a foto só do rosto é melhor tá eu tenho aqui mas vou fazer para simplificar porque talvez algumas pessoas não Consigam é tirar só a foto do rosto dá muito trabalho tem só a foto ele vai aceitar tá então tem aqui o Pedro tá algumas fotos do Pedro algumas fotos do Rafão aqui e algumas fotos minhas tá então beleza aí ó são as fotos tal que eu vou mandar aqui pro sistema para reconhecer certo então vamos lá vamos para poder fazer o reconhecimento facial eu preciso aqui o seguinte eu preciso e fazer o image ports tá vou aumentar aqui um pouquinho e eu vou colocar aqui a vou selecionar aqui aquela pasta tá bom aqui aí você seleciona a sua pasta e veja cada pastinha dessa vai ter uma pessoa correspondente aí que você queira fazer o reconhecimento facial então seleciona a pasta ele vai processar essas imagens né vai carregar as imagens aqui ó vai começar a carregar as imagens e nós temos aí 251 imagens tá se você quiser ver essas imagens aqui basta usar o image viewer tá colocar o me vi aqui do lado ligou abriu você tem aí todas as imagens que foram carregadas tá essas imagens aqui tem as imagens da Etiene né do Pedro pedrocão tem as imagens do Rafa e as minhas Tá certo ok tá tudo aí ó ó Que camisa linda né Essa camisa é linda demais OK próximo passo então é um reconhecimento eh de imagens né a gente vai trabalhar com o imag beddings tá o imag beding o que que é ele transforma a imagem e em um um vetor de informações é como se fosse uma assinatura da imagem tá só que antes de qualquer coisa eu vou abrir aqui ó porque por padrão o image beding ele está com Exception V3 tá e eu vou trocar esse image embed aqui esse embedder certo para Open face ó que legal E aí você vai ter uma rede que é especialista né em reconhecer Faces tá em reconhecer Faces então muito bem agora o que você faz é ligar pode ocorrer de algumas imagens est numa codificação que o o open Face não aceite então ele vai pular algumas imagens certo provavelmente ele vai pular algumas imagens aqui mas agora tá codificando os embeds aí ó e quando ele pular assim ignorar algumas imagens ele vai dizer Eh quantas imagens foram ignoradas tá bom é isso aí processando muito bem aí quando você clica aqui duas vezes ó 110 imagens foram ignoradas então sim é uma quantidade grande de imagem por isso que é importante quando você fazer o sistema aqui você tem um volume grande de imagens tá Pelo menos tem um volume grande de imagens das pessoas que você quer reconhecer muito bem o próximo passo aqui eu vou colocar aqui um um um data aqui né ó muito bem então vou colocar aqui agora um data table pra gente ver esses embeddings tá vou clicar aqui duas vezes e o que eu tenho aqui agora é esse aqui ó as imagens né de quem de quem é a pessoa a classe a categoria né você v que tem aqui do Rafa minha tal e eu tenho aqui esses valores aqui numéricos ó esses são exatamente os embeddings os embeddings os embeddings que eu tô vou usar para poder fazer exatamente a o reconhecimento facial veja que ess aqui ó são 128 posições né de 0 a 127 certo e eu vou fazer o seguinte eu vou aqui em visualizar vou pedir a distribuição quero que você quero que ele me mostre aqui Quais são as as categorias né então vou abrir aqui então temos aí por categoria tem menos né Bem menos e tem sandeco Beleza você eh e tenta equilibrar essas essas essas essas bases aqui eu coloquei propositalmente aqui só para ver se ele é eh ele consegue de forma desbalanceada classificar legal certo vamos ver o que isso acontece isso é bom vamos lá agora o que eu vou fazer o próximo passo é exatamente Ah fazer a o sistema mesmo funcionar né vamos aqui em evaluate eu vou colocar aqui test and score para avaliar qual seria o melhor algoritmo de aprendizagem de máquina e para poder fazer a classificação Veja essa parte aqui do imag beddings é Deep learning tá porque é uma rede neural e profunda que é a Open Face para extrair essas características no próximo passo que é classificar pode ser qualquer algoritmo de machine learning por exemplo aqui eu vou usar aqui o AD Boost vou ligar aqui eu quero saber qual que é melhor né vou usar aqui o Random Forest que é um algoritmo muito bom beleza e vou usar aqui uma neural Network tá vamos lá então muito bem agora agora abrindo aqui o test and score você vai ver aqui ó as os a os níveis de classificação né e eu tenho aqui pela acurácia ó se eu ordenar pela acurácia aqui eu tenho a rede neural com 0.
Copyright © 2025. Made with ♥ in London by YTScribe.com